**Q: How does the cleaning crew get in overnight?**

The Ostrell Cleaning crew arrives between 22:00 and 23:00 via the rear service entrance at Fennick House. They do not hold permanent badges; the night shift signs them in against the roster posted in the security booth. Crew members must stay on floors 1–4 and may not enter the server room. The service entrance keypad accepts the rotating crew code shown below.

staff pass of yafof-baweg = bdg-OLNEG-5

Runbook: Tablefeed CSV Import Wizard. If an import hangs past ten minutes, check the parser queue first — oversized files get stuck on the encoding-detection step. Cancel the job, have the user re-export as UTF-8, and retry. Do not delete staged rows manually. Step-by-step recovery instructions are on the internal page here.

operations page: https://jenkins.zemvarcloud.local/job/merge_requests/repo/build/73930b4b30f0a8ed

## Payroll Export: Format Migration (Ledgerwren v4)

As of this cycle, the Ledgerwren payroll exporter emits column-delimited records instead of fixed-width blocks. New team members: always verify the header row before uploading to the Tallyforth intake portal, since legacy files will silently pass validation but misalign net-pay fields. Run the preflight script, confirm the record count matches the roster snapshot, and archive the old-format file for thirty days. The export job stamps each file with the build that produced it.

pipeline stamp: htk9_ce63042d9

The Lattermill handlers exhibit noticeably longer cold starts locally because the emulator initializes the full dependency graph on first invocation. Before cutting a release, warm each handler twice and record timings in the release notes; anything above four seconds warrants investigation. Keep the pre-warm script in your shell profile so measurements stay comparable across builds. The handlers also validate their database reachability during initialization, so ensure the local instance accepts the connection string provided below.

primary connection of yagep-kahip = redis://giliel_svc:zYiKsLL2PLpfPL@db-348f.xolmarsys.corp:5432/fenwyn